The file is identified as malicious by ClamAV with the signature Pdf.Exploit.Agent-22448. Static analysis revealed embedded JavaScript within a PDF structure, triggered by an optional content group. This suggests the file attempts to exploit a PDF vulnerability to execute arbitrary code. The exact nature of the JavaScript payload could not be determined due to potential obfuscation, but its presence is a strong indicator of malicious intent.

JavaScript action low PDF_JAVASCRIPTPDF contains a /JavaScript action. Generic JavaScript is common in benign forms; specific dangerous APIs are scored by separate rules.
-
Embedded JS stream low PDF_JSPDF references a /JS stream. Generic JavaScript is common in benign forms; specific dangerous APIs are scored by separate rules.
-
Optional Content Group with action trigger low PDF_OPTIONAL_CONTENTOptional Content Group (layer) co-occurs with an action trigger — content can be selectively hidden from viewers or scanners while the action still fires on open
